@ -0,0 +1,77 @@
|
|||
# shellcheck shell=bash
|
||||
|
||||
# Golden test support
|
||||
#
|
||||
# Test that the output of the given test matches what is expected. If
|
||||
# `_NIX_TEST_ACCEPT` is non-empty also update the expected output so
|
||||
# that next time the test succeeds.
|
||||
function diffAndAcceptInner() {
|
||||
local -r testName=$1
|
||||
local -r got="$2"
|
||||
local -r expected="$3"
|
||||
|
||||
# Absence of expected file indicates empty output expected.
|
||||
if test -e "$expected"; then
|
||||
local -r expectedOrEmpty="$expected"
|
||||
else
|
||||
local -r expectedOrEmpty=characterisation/empty
|
||||
fi
|
||||
|
||||
# Diff so we get a nice message
|
||||
if ! diff --color=always --unified "$expectedOrEmpty" "$got"; then
|
||||
echo "FAIL: evaluation result of $testName not as expected"
|
||||
# shellcheck disable=SC2034
|
||||
badDiff=1
|
||||
fi
|
||||
|
||||
# Update expected if `_NIX_TEST_ACCEPT` is non-empty.
|
||||
if test -n "${_NIX_TEST_ACCEPT-}"; then
|
||||
cp "$got" "$expected"
|
||||
# Delete empty expected files to avoid bloating the repo with
|
||||
# empty files.
|
||||
if ! test -s "$expected"; then
|
||||
rm "$expected"
|
||||
fi
|
||||
fi
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
function characterisationTestExit() {
|
||||
# Make sure shellcheck knows all these will be defined by the caller
|
||||
: "${badDiff?} ${badExitCode?}"
|
||||
|
||||
if test -n "${_NIX_TEST_ACCEPT-}"; then
|
||||
if (( "$badDiff" )); then
|
||||
set +x
|
||||
echo 'Output did mot match, but accepted output as the persisted expected output.'
|
||||
echo 'That means the next time the tests are run, they should pass.'
|
||||
set -x
|
||||
else
|
||||
set +x
|
||||
echo 'NOTE: Environment variable _NIX_TEST_ACCEPT is defined,'
|
||||
echo 'indicating the unexpected output should be accepted as the expected output going forward,'
|
||||
echo 'but no tests had unexpected output so there was no expected output to update.'
|
||||
set -x
|
||||
fi
|
||||
if (( "$badExitCode" )); then
|
||||
exit "$badExitCode"
|
||||
else
|
||||
skipTest "regenerating golden masters"
|
||||
fi
|
||||
else
|
||||
if (( "$badDiff" )); then
|
||||
set +x
|
||||
echo ''
|
||||
echo 'You can rerun this test with:'
|
||||
echo ''
|
||||
echo " _NIX_TEST_ACCEPT=1 make tests/functional/${TEST_NAME}.test"
|
||||
echo ''
|
||||
echo 'to regenerate the files containing the expected output,'
|
||||
echo 'and then view the git diff to decide whether a change is'
|
||||
echo 'good/intentional or bad/unintentional.'
|
||||
echo 'If the diff contains arbitrary or impure information,'
|
||||
echo 'please improve the normalization that the test applies to the output.'
|
||||
set -x
|
||||
fi
|
||||
exit $(( "$badExitCode" + "$badDiff" ))
|
||||
fi
|
||||
}
